How do taper bushes work?
Mounting a Taper Bushing is very easy and can be performed without the need for special skills or equipment. Grub screws are used to tighten the component onto the shaft. The bushing is drawn into the component as the grub screws are tightened and the downward pressure from the component clamps the bushing onto the shaft.

Typical Applications
Taper bushes are widely used in:
-
Roller chain sprockets
-
V-belt pulleys and timing pulleys
-
Gear drives and industrial machinery
-
Conveyor systems and material handling
-
Agricultural and packaging equipment
They are essential wherever precise, reliable, and easily adjustable shaft mounting is required.
